Lihtne on veeta tunde ekraani ees, teadmata, kuhu aeg läks. Teil on iga päev aega kulutada ainult 24 tundi ja saate valida, kas kulutada aega olulistele ülesannetele või raisata seda tarbetutele tegevustele.
Õnneks on Linuxis ekraaniaja jälgimine lihtne, et tuvastada tegevused, mis võivad põhjustada fookuse kaotamist. Võib-olla soovite jälgida oma lapse tegevust Internetis ja vajate tõhusat tööriista, mis seda teie eest saaks teha. ActivityWatch on avatud lähtekoodiga rakendus, mis aitab teil Linuxis ekraaniaega kontrollida.
ActivityWatch'i peamised esiletõstmised
Aktiivse ekraaniaja jälgimine on üks neist parimaid viise oma tootlikkuse suurendamiseks ja saate lühema ajaga rohkem asju korda saata.
Selle asemel, et lihtsalt jälgida ekraanil veedetud aega, toob ActivityWatch tabelisse mõned lisafunktsioonid, näiteks:
- Tegevuste rühmitamine kategooriate kaupa
- Ekraaniaja jälgimine akna/rakenduse järgi
- Veebikasutuse jälgimine brauseri laienduste abil
- Stopperi funktsioon käsitsi aktiivsuse jälgimiseks
- Platvormideülene tugi Windowsi, macOS-i, Linuxi ja Androidi jaoks
- Andmete eksportimine JSON- ja CSV-vormingus
Parim osa on see, et kuna ActivityWatch töötab kohaliku serverina, salvestab see teie andmed kohapeal, pakkudes teile täielikku kontrolli oma privaatsuse üle.
ActivityWatchi kasutamise alustamiseks peate selle esmalt oma süsteemi installima.
ActivityWatchi installimine Linuxisse
ActivityWatch pole enamiku Linuxi distributsioonide ametlikes hoidlates saadaval, seetõttu peate binaarfailid projekti veebisaidilt käsitsi alla laadima. Minge veebisaidile ActivityWatch ja laadige alla oma süsteemi uusim versioon.
Lae alla:ActivityWatch
Arch Linuxi kasutajad saavad ActivityWatchi alla laadida saidilt Arch User Repository (AUR) kasutades yay:
jah -S tegevuskell
ActivityWatchi käivitamine
Esimene samm on ActivityWatch käivitamine. Te ei leia seda rakenduste menüüs, kuna te ei installinud seda oma distro hoidlatest. See on lihtne luua rakenduste otseteid mis tahes programmi jaoks Linuxissiiski.
Kui olete rakenduse AUR-ist alla laadinud, saate selle käivitada rakenduste menüüst, kuna AUR-i abistajad loovad installitud tarkvara jaoks menüükirje.
Alustamiseks minge kausta Allalaadimised ja pakkige ZIP-fail välja laadisid just alla:
sudolahti pakkimategevuskell-*.zip
Muutke praegune kataloog ekstraktitud kaustaks, kasutades:
cd tegevuskell
Seejärel sisestage ActivityWatchi käivitamiseks järgmine käsk:
./aw-qt
Ekraaniaja jälgimine Linuxis ActivityWatchi abil
Vaikimisi käivitub ActivityWatch taustal ja selle seadistamiseks pole rakenduseliidest. Kuna see töötab serverina, saate andmete vaatamiseks ja muutmiseks veebipõhise armatuurlaua.
ActivityWatchi armatuurlauale pääsemiseks paremklõpsake süsteemisalves ActivityWatchi ikooni ja valige Avage armatuurlaud.
Iga kord, kui rakenduse käivitate, suunatakse teid automaatselt tervituslehele, mis sisaldab kõiki olulisi üksikasju projekti kohta ja mõningaid platvormilinke arendaja toetamiseks.
Selle vaikekäitumise muutmiseks ja tegevuste armatuurlaua avamiseks käivitamisel klõpsake Seaded paremast ülanurgast ja valige Tegevus alates Sihtleht rippmenüüst.
Ekraanil kuvatava tegevuse jälgimine
Suurem osa teie jälgimise töövoost keerleb ümber Tegevus ja Ajaskaala vaated. Vahekaardil Tegevus kuvatakse teie ekraaniaeg rakenduste, kategooriate ja akende kaupa rühmitatuna.
Teil on ka mõned kenad sektor- ja tulpdiagrammid, mis teie andmeid visualiseerivad, kuid suurem osa neist on esialgu tühjad. Seetõttu laske ActivityWatchil paar tundi taustal töötada, enne kui kaalute armatuurlaua uuesti avamist.
Ülaservast leiate valikud andmete filtreerimiseks kuupäeva ja kellaaja valimiseks. Vaikimisi kuvab ActivityWatch jooksva päeva andmed, kuid saate neid hõlpsalt muuta päeva- ja kuupäevafiltrite abil. Saate andmeid filtreerida ka kategooriate järgi või välistada AFK-aja, kuid peate klõpsama nuppu Filtrid nuppu, et neile valikutele juurde pääseda.
Allpool asuvad tegelikud andmed. Oma tegevused leiate rakenduste, akende pealkirjade ja töökategooriate järgi rühmitatuna.
ActivityWatch teeb suurepärast tööd kategooria tuvastamisel akna või rakenduse nime alusel. Näiteks kui kasutate redaktorit, nagu Visual Studio Code, langeb kogu selle rakenduse tegevus ja ekraaniaeg Töö>Programmeerimine kategooria.
Täiendavaid visualiseerimisi saate lisada klõpsates Redigeeri vaadet ja siis Lisage visualiseerimine. Ilmuvas uues jaotises klõpsake Seaded rippmenüüst ja valige, millist visualiseerimist soovite armatuurlauale lisada. Siis löö Salvesta jätkama.
Soovi korral saate oma andmed eksportida ka JSON- või CSV-vormingus, klõpsates nuppu Algandmed, seejärel valides asjakohase Ekspordi valik alates Rohkem rippmenüü, mis asub iga ämbri kõrval.
Tegevuse ajaskaala vaatamine
Saate ülaosast lülituda vahekaardile Ajaskaala, et pääseda juurde kogu oma tööajaloole. Saate kena horisontaalse ajaskaala, millel on kaks erinevat rida: üks on AFK jälgija, mis jälgib teie aega olid klaviatuurist eemal ja teine on aknavaatleja, mis jälgib teie tegevust ja jälgib teie rakendusi kasutada.
Andmete sortimiseks ja täpsustamiseks saate kasutada ajaskaala kohal olevaid filtrisuvandeid. Sellega saate mängida!
Tegevuse käsitsi jälgimine ActivityWatchi abil
Teine ActivityWatchi suurepärane tahk on stopperi funktsioon. Kuigi see on praegu katsefaasis, saate seda siiski kasutada kohandatud tegevusele kulutatud tundide jälgimiseks.
Klõpsake nuppu Stopper võimalus sellele funktsioonile juurde pääseda. Kõik, mida pead tegema, on sisestada tegevus ja klõpsata Alustaja ActivityWatch käivitab stopperi, et jälgida aega, mille te selleks kulutate. Ärge unustage stopperit peatada kohe pärast ülesande lõpetamist.
Oma aja jälgimine Linuxis
Ekraanil toimuvate tegevuste jälgimine raisatud aja eest on asendamatu harjumus, mille peaksite kohe omaks võtma. Teadmine, mis teid tööl olles segab, ja oma "voolust" välja libisemise tõenäosuse vähendamine on fantastiline viis oma päevast lisatunde varastada.
Me elame praegu kiires maailmas, kus isegi üks säästetud tund tähendab, et teil on rohkem aega oma kallimaga koos veeta tegelege oma isiklike huvidega või isegi õppige uusi oskusi, mis muudavad teid oma valdkonnas pädevaks ja asendamatuks. töökoht.